Interview magazine pulled out all the stops for their September 09 issue. These are a few of the pics from the editorial titled"Gimme More" and this is not Britney bitches! It features Alla Kostromicheva, Constance Jablonski, Magdalena Frackowiak, Monika Jagaciak and Sigrid Agren; it's shot by Craig McDean and styled by Karl Templer. I love the edge and sex that exudes from these pics. Karl did a great job styling these girls.
